I know the frustration. I gave up drilling out, because it often leaves you with more work, if it even works to remove the stud. I just weld a nut or another bolt to it now. If its flush, or sub-surface, use a hollow steel tube/pipe small enough to fit but large enough to get some weld down in the inside of this tube. then weld a nut to it. The added heat from welding always pops these loose.
